ベイズ推定の実例で学ぶ!データ分析の革命的手法とその応用

data

近年、データを活用した意思決定の重要性が高まっています。しかし、データだけでは不確実性が残ってしまうことがあります。そこで、ベイズ推定という手法が注目されています。ベイズ推定は、既存の知識や経験に基づく確率的な推定と、新しく得られたデータを組み合わせることで、より正確な推定を行うことができます。このブログでは、ベイズ推定の基本的な考え方から実例、さらには応用までを幅広く解説していきます。ベイズ推定の有用性と可能性について理解を深めましょう。

目次

1. ベイズ推定の基本的な考え方

ベイズ推定とは

ベイズ推定は、既存の知識と新たに得られたデータを組み合わせて、確率的な推定を行う手法です。この方法では、事前の情報である事前確率をもとに、観測データをともに考慮し、事後確率を計算します。この流れにより、以前の知見に基づいた推測をより正確に更新することができます。

ベイズの定理の概要

ベイズ推定の根底には、ベイズの定理が存在します。この定理は次のような数式で表されます:

[ P(A|B) = \frac{P(B|A) \cdot P(A)}{P(B)} ]

ここで、( P(A|B) ) はBがあるときのAの確率、( P(B|A) ) はAのもとでのBの確率を示しています。また、( P(A) ) は事前確率、( P(B) ) はBが現れる全体の確率です。この定理に基づくことで、実際のデータからより具体的な確率を得ることが可能になります。

不確実性を捉える

ベイズ推定の特筆すべき点は、不確実性を適切に考慮に入れることです。我々の周りの実世界は複雑で、多くの要因が互いに影響を及ぼします。完全な情報を得ることは難しく、ベイズ推定はこのような状況でも、事前の知識を活かしながら新しいデータを考慮し、事後確率を更新することで、合理的な意思決定を支援します。

事前確率の重要性

ベイズ推定の過程で特に重要なステップは、事前確率の設定です。この事前確率は、特定の事象が起きる可能性についての事前の認識や仮説に基づいて決まります。専門家の知見や歴史的なデータを考慮することで、事前確率は評価され、この値は結果に大きな影響を及ぼします。

尤度とデータの統合

新たに得たデータに基づいて尤度を評価し、これがどれだけ特定の仮説を支持するかを示します。事前確率とこの尤度を融合させることで、信頼性の高い推定が行えるようになります。

推定の更新プロセス

ベイズ推定の中心的なプロセスは、事前確率と尤度を用いて事後確率を導出することです。この更新は繰り返し可能で、新たなデータが入手されるたびに推定の精度を向上させることができます。これによって、データに基づいた柔軟かつ的確な意思決定が実現します。

まとめ

以上が、ベイズ推定の基本的な考え方です。事前の知識と新しい情報を統合することで、より良い意思決定が支援されるこの手法を理解することで、多くの領域での効果的な判断が可能になります。

2. 実例で学ぶベイズ推定

ベイズ推定を深く理解するためには、実践的な事例を通じてそのメカニズムを学ぶことが非常に効果的です。このセクションでは、具体的なシナリオに基づいてベイズ推定の原則を解説していきます。

2.1 飴を使った例

まず、2つの箱AとBを考えてみましょう。それぞれの箱には異なる種類の飴が入っています。箱Aにはソーダ味の飴が2個とハチミツ味の飴が6個、箱Bにはソーダ味の飴が8個、ハチミツ味が4個入っています。この状況を使ってベイズ推定を説明します。

  1. 箱の選定
    最初に、箱Aか箱Bのいずれかを無作為に選び、その箱から飴を1個取り出します。この時点で、どちらの箱から飴が選ばれる確率は以下のようになります。
  • P(H1) = 箱Aが選ばれる確率 = 1/2
  • P(H2) = 箱Bが選ばれる確率 = 1/2
  1. 飴の選定
    次に、取り出した飴がソーダ味であることが判明しました。この情報を基に、実際にどの箱から飴が取り出された可能性が高いかを考察します。ここで、条件付き確率を算出します。
  • P(D|H1) = 箱Aからソーダ味の飴を選ぶ確率 = 2/8 = 1/4
  • P(D|H2) = 箱Bからソーダ味の飴を選ぶ確率 = 8/12 = 2/3

2.2 ベイズの定理の適用

ここで、ベイズの定理を利用して、箱Bから飴が取り出された確率を計算してみましょう。次の式を使用します。

[
P(H2|D) = \frac{P(H2) \times P(D|H2)}{P(H1) \times P(D|H1) + P(H2) \times P(D|H2)}
]

計算してみると、以下のようになります。

[
P(H2|D) = \frac{(1/2) \times (2/3)}{(1/2) \times (2/3) + (1/2) \times (1/4)} = \frac{(1/3)}{(1/3) + (1/8)} = \frac{(8/24)}{(8/24) + (3/24)} = \frac{8}{11}
]

この計算から分かるように、初期の確率を新しいデータで修正し、より現実的な確率を求めることができるのがベイズ推定の特長です。

2.3 経済学における応用

ベイズ推定は経済学においても幅広く利用されています。たとえば、消費者の購買行動を分析するとき、過去のデータをもとに未来の消費傾向を予測することが可能です。予め得られた情報を元に新しい販売データを組み合わせることで、将来の動向をより正確に見積もることができます。

このように、ベイズ推定は理論に留まらず、ビジネス界でも非常に有用なツールとして機能しています。

2.4 医療領域での活用

医療分野でも、ベイズ推定は重要な役割を果たしています。新しい治療法の効果を評価する際、過去の研究成果や治療結果を基に事前確率を設け、新たな患者データを通じて治療の効果を導き出すことが可能です。

さらに、ベイズ推定を用いることで患者それぞれのリスク評価や診断精度を向上させ、個別化された医療の実践に貢献します。

2.5 統計モデルにおける利用

ベイズ推定はデータ解析や統計モデルで幅広く採用されており、特に複雑なデータに対する理解を深めるための強力な手法として多くのデータサイエンティストに支持されています。ベイズモデルを通じて、不確実性を明示的に示しながら、解釈しやすい結果を得ることが可能です。

このように、ベイズ推定の具体的な事例を考えることは、その様々な応用を理解する上で不可欠です。さまざまな分野における実績を考慮し、特定の状況でのベイズ推定の効果を考察してみましょう。

3. ベイズ推定の応用と重要性

ビジネス分野における意思決定のサポート

ビジネス環境において、ベイズ推定は非常に重要な役割を果たしています。特に、マーケティング施策や顧客行動の予測においては、過去のデータを基に新しい情報を取り込みながら、より効果的な戦略を策定することが可能です。顧客のセグメント化やリスクアセスメントの過程では、ベイズ手法が頻繁に採用される傾向にあります。

医療現場での重要性

医療の分野でも、ベイズ推定はその重要性を増しています。病気の罹患率や新しい治療法の効果を評価する際には、事前に得られた研究データと最新の臨床試験結果を統合することで、より正確で信頼性の高い診断を行うことができます。この手法は、高い不確実性の下でも、エビデンスに基づいた治療方針を選択する助けとなります。

環境問題への適用

環境科学の分野でも、ベイズ推定は貴重なツールです。気候変動の予測や、絶滅の危機にある生物種のリスク評価において、既存のデータを活用しながら新しい情報を統合することで、より精密な未来の見通しを立てることが可能です。特に、データが限られている状況下においても、過去の知見を生かして不確実な問題にアプローチできる点が特徴です。

技術革新とデータ解析の進展

現代の技術進化の中で、ベイズ推定はデータ分析に不可欠な手法として位置付けられています。例えば、機械学習のモデルを発展させる際にこの手法を利用することで、モデルの精度を向上させることができます。新たなデータを繰り返し取り込むことにより、継続的にモデルの性能を最適化することが実現されます。

教育と研究における影響

教育や研究の場でも、ベイズ推定の重要性が高まっています。特に科学研究の過程では、事前の仮説とその後の実験データを組み合わせることで、より信頼性のある結論を導き出すことができます。情報が限られている状況でも妥当な推論を行うことができ、未知の領域を探る際の強力な手段として認識されています。

このように、ベイズ推定は多様な分野で活用され続け、その適用範囲は日々広がっています。不確実性に対処し、データに基づく合理的な決定を支援することで、私たちの日常生活や仕事に一層の貢献をしていくでしょう。

4. ベイズ推定とその他の統計手法の違い

ベイズ推定は、統計学において多くの場面で活用されている手法であり、他の統計的アプローチとは異なる視点や目的を持っています。本セクションでは、ベイズ推定と最尤推定、および頻度主義的手法との主要な違いについて詳しく探っていきます。

ベイズ推定と最尤推定の違い

アプローチの違い
ベイズ推定は、事前確率を活用して新しいデータを組み込み、事後確率を計算することを特徴としています。これにより、既存の知識や観測されたデータに基づいて仮説を進化させることが可能です。一方で、最尤推定は得られたデータのみに依存し、最も可能性の高いパラメータセットを求める方法であり、事前の情報は考慮されません。

不確実性の扱い

データの不確実性への配慮
ベイズ推定の利点の一つは、データ分析に伴う不確実性を測定し、それを結果に反映させることができる点です。出力は確率分布として提示され、意思決定のための重要な情報を提供します。対し、最尤推定は一つの点推定値を示すだけで、その結果に内在する不確実性にはあまり触れません。

データ依存性の違い

データ量に対する依存性
ベイズ推定は、事前分布を設定することができるため、少ないデータでも信頼できる推定を行うことができます。そのため、既存の知識を組み入れた信頼性の高い分析が可能です。一方、最尤推定は多くのデータを必要とし、特にデータ量が増えるほど精度が上がりますが、逆に少ない場合は結果が不安定になることがあります。

モデル適用性の違い

モデルに対する柔軟性
ベイズ推定は、多様な事前分布を使用することで、複雑なモデルにも対応できる柔軟性があります。このため、様々なデータセットに対して適応しやすいという特徴があります。反対に、最尤推定は特定のモデルをベースにパラメータを最適化するため、モデル選択の自由度は制限されることが多いです。

使用場面の違い

応用の幅広さ
ベイズ推定は、不確実性を考慮し、データが逐次的に収集される状況で特に有用です。このため、医療・金融・環境科学など、多岐にわたる分野での応用が見られます。それに対して、最尤推定は、データが明確に得られたときに迅速に推測を行う局面でその力を発揮します。

これらの違いを明確に理解することは、特定の状況や目的に応じた最適な手法を選択するために非常に大切です。特に不確実性が高い場合においては、ベイズ推定が非常に有力な選択肢となるでしょう。

5. ベイズ推定を実践する上での課題と対策

5.1. モデルの選定と事前分布の設定

ベイズ推定の実践において最初の大きな課題は、モデルの選定と事前分布の設定です。適切なモデルを選定することは、正確な結果を得るために不可欠です。また、事前分布は推定結果に大きな影響を与えるため、どのように設定するかは慎重に考慮しなければなりません。

対策
モデル選定は段階的に行うことが重要です。データに基づいたモデル構築を行い、過去の研究や理論を参考にすることで、より信頼性の高いモデルを選定できます。また、事前分布については可能な限りデータに基づき wählen し、場合によっては感度分析を行い、事前分布の影響を確認しましょう。

5.2. 計算の複雑性

ベイズ推定は、計算が複雑になる場合があります。特に多変量データや大規模データの処理では、計算コストが高くなることがあります。この複雑性が、リアルタイムでの予測やオンライン学習の障害となることもあります。

対策
計算アルゴリズムの選択が鍵となります。マルコフ連鎖モンテカルロ法(MCMC)などの先進的なアルゴリズムを用いることで、計算の効率を向上させることが可能です。また、ハードウェアの性能を活用することや、クラウドコンピューティングを利用することも効果的です。

5.3. データの不足

ベイズ推定は事前情報を活用するため、十分なデータがない場合、推定結果が不安定になることがあります。特に現実世界の問題では、理想的なデータセットを得ることが難しいことも多いです。

対策
データ不足の問題を解決するためには、外部データの収集やドメイン専門家の知見を導入することが役立ちます。また、シミュレーションデータを生成することで、モデルの robust 性を確保する方法も考えられます。データの前処理や特徴選択を適切に行うことも、モデルの精度向上に繋がります。

5.4. モデルの評価と適合度

ベイズ推定では、得られた結果の評価とモデルの適合度を確認することが重要です。しかし、どの指標を用いるべきかは一律ではなく、特定のアプリケーションに応じた選択が求められます。

対策
クロスバリデーションや後方確率の計算を用いることで、モデルの評価を行いましょう。また、適合度評価の指標を事前に決定し、複数の指標を用いてモデルを比較することで、より信頼性のある評価が可能です。

5.5. コミュニケーションの重要性

ベイズ推定を利用する際には、結果やプロセスの透明性が重要です。ステークホルダーとのコミュニケーションが不足していると、誤解や不信感を招くことがあります。

対策
結果をわかりやすく伝えるためにビジュアルツールを活用し、複雑な結果をシンプルに説明する努力が求められます。また、推定に使用した前提や仮定についても明確にし、説明責任を果たすことで信頼を高めることができます。

まとめ

ベイズ推定は、事前の知識と新しいデータの統合によって、より正確で柔軟な推定を実現する強力な手法です。この手法は、不確実性の高い状況下でも合理的な意思決定を支援し、さまざまな分野での実践的な活用が進んでいます。ただし、適切なモデル設定や計算の複雑さ、データ不足などの課題にも直面するため、専門性を持って慎重に対処することが重要です。ベイズ推定の基礎と応用を理解し、状況に応じた適切な利用を心がけることで、より科学的で効果的な分析が可能になるでしょう。

よかったらシェアしてね!
  • URLをコピーしました!
  • URLをコピーしました!

この記事を書いた人

 大学卒業後、デジタルマーケティング企業に入社し、BtoBマーケティングのコンサルに従事。200社以上のコンサルティング経験に加え、ウェビナー・ワークショップ・Academyサイトの立ち上げに携わり、年間40件のイベント登壇と70件の学習コンテンツ制作を担当。
 その後、起業を志す中で、施策先行型のサービス展開ではなく企業の本質的な体質改善を促せる事業を展開できるよう、AI/DX分野において実績のあるAIソリューション企業へ転職。
 現在はAIソリューション企業に所属しながら、個人としてもAI×マーケティング分野で”未経験でもわかりやすく”をコンセプトに情報発信活動やカジュアル相談を実施中。

目次